![]() |
Модераторы: LSD |
![]() ![]() ![]() |
|
Arantir |
|
|||
Рыбак без удочки ![]() ![]() Профиль Группа: Участник Сообщений: 960 Регистрация: 18.11.2012 Репутация: нет Всего: 55 |
Никогда не делал сайты на чем-то, кроме php. Хотя и C#, и Java знаю, но на них с вебом дела не имел.
Создание сайта у многих ассоциируется именно с php. Неужели php - это что-то такое удобнейшее из всего, на чем можно сделать сайт? Давайте отбросим с сторону то, что называют web-приложениями, как например Wolfram Alfa с его математически аппаратом, и оставим то, что можно назвать только сайтом. Ну, например, почему не пишут форумы на ASP? А может пишут? Может я вот тут за свою недолгую практику все время ошибался и даже какой-то простой сайтик-визитку лучше, быстрее и удобнее писать на чем-то другом, а не на php? -------------------- interface Жопа { // ATTENTION: has to be implemented by every class of the project for proper project work } |
|||
|
||||
Akella |
|
||||
![]() Творец ![]() ![]() ![]() ![]() Профиль Группа: Модератор Сообщений: 18485 Регистрация: 14.5.2003 Где: Корусант Репутация: 1 Всего: 329 |
Мне, какжется, что большая популярность из-за халявности. Добавлено через 1 минуту и 1 секунду
или взять готовую CMS ![]() |
||||
|
|||||
Фантом |
|
|||
![]() Вы это прекратите! ![]() ![]() ![]() Профиль Группа: Участник Клуба Сообщений: 1516 Регистрация: 23.3.2008 Репутация: нет Всего: 49 |
||||
|
||||
Arantir |
|
|||
Рыбак без удочки ![]() ![]() Профиль Группа: Участник Сообщений: 960 Регистрация: 18.11.2012 Репутация: нет Всего: 55 |
-------------------- interface Жопа { // ATTENTION: has to be implemented by every class of the project for proper project work } |
|||
|
||||
Arantir |
|
|||
Рыбак без удочки ![]() ![]() Профиль Группа: Участник Сообщений: 960 Регистрация: 18.11.2012 Репутация: нет Всего: 55 |
Почитал тут и там... Наверное ответ звучит примерно так:
PHP и уже является шаблонизатором, и содержит удобный API для работы с БД и прочим, да и вообще сам по себе предназначен для веба. Если подумать, то сам PHP уже является фреймворком ![]() Чего стоит разделить логику и вывод? Впихнуть в один файл набор функций get<somevar>(), а в другой файл впихнуть include и echo этих функций в нужных местах между HTML. Смотрите - выводи и модель разделены! И это ж чисто PHP. -------------------- interface Жопа { // ATTENTION: has to be implemented by every class of the project for proper project work } |
|||
|
||||
k0rvin |
|
|||
![]() Опытный ![]() ![]() Профиль Группа: Участник Сообщений: 442 Регистрация: 24.1.2010 Репутация: 1 Всего: 5 |
SQL.ru вроде на ASP. Быстрее и удобней на Ruby on Rails. Фишка в том, что бесплатных и/или недорогих хостингов с апачем, мускулем и пхп дофига и больше и их для визиток вполне достаточно. -------------------- “Object-oriented design is the roman numerals of computing.” — Rob Pike All software sucks |
|||
|
||||
skyboy |
|
|||
неОпытный ![]() ![]() ![]() ![]() Профиль Группа: Модератор Сообщений: 9820 Регистрация: 18.5.2006 Где: Днепропетровск Репутация: 1 Всего: 260 |
ну, че. на ASP.NET — из пушки по воробьям. ибо при стоимости ISS + MSSQL Server сайты-визитки делать нет смысла. разве что ентерпрайз-порталы какие-то.
Ruby on Rails, Django@python тоже вполне хвалимы народом и удобны для быстрой разработки(чего только сто́ит автогенерация админки) с другой стороны, Drupal/Joomla@php тоже довольно функциональны и удобны, а на рынке дольше → коммьнити шире. Так что, не ASP.NET, а RoR/Django в той же нише. |
|||
|
||||
Arantir |
|
|||
Рыбак без удочки ![]() ![]() Профиль Группа: Участник Сообщений: 960 Регистрация: 18.11.2012 Репутация: нет Всего: 55 |
Ну вот Facebook на php сделан. Хотя его вполне могли сделать, например, на python. И проблемы стоимости хостинга перед ними не стояли. Но они выбрали php.
-------------------- interface Жопа { // ATTENTION: has to be implemented by every class of the project for proper project work } |
|||
|
||||
serger |
|
|||
Опытный ![]() ![]() Профиль Группа: Участник Сообщений: 518 Регистрация: 19.6.2007 Где: Ижевск Репутация: 0 Всего: 5 |
Arantir, смешно, да - http://nerds-central.blogspot.ru/2012/08/f...ing-to-jvm.html ?
у них не совсем PHP - они свой компилятор написали же... Теперь вот такие слухи ходят. -------------------- упс! |
|||
|
||||
Arantir |
|
|||
Рыбак без удочки ![]() ![]() Профиль Группа: Участник Сообщений: 960 Регистрация: 18.11.2012 Репутация: нет Всего: 55 |
Буду знать =)
Но я так понял, что для небольшого проекта все же не стоит зазря дергаться? Где слышал, то ASP чаще выбирают потому, что "на нем у них больше опыта и потому лично им удобнее и быстрее". Крупные проекты придумывают собственные решения. Проектам с большой и сложной бизнес-логикой (моделью) уже практически все равно, на чем ее писать. А в остальном PHP не хуже. Так? -------------------- interface Жопа { // ATTENTION: has to be implemented by every class of the project for proper project work } |
|||
|
||||
LSD |
|
|||
![]() Leprechaun Software Developer ![]() ![]() ![]() ![]() Профиль Группа: Модератор Сообщений: 15718 Регистрация: 24.3.2004 Где: Dublin Репутация: 9 Всего: 538 |
-------------------- Disclaimer: this post contains explicit depictions of personal opinion. So, if it sounds sarcastic, don't take it seriously. If it sounds dangerous, do not try this at home or at all. And if it offends you, just don't read it. |
|||
|
||||
Freyzer |
|
|||
![]() обаятельный нахал ![]() ![]() Профиль Группа: Участник Сообщений: 277 Регистрация: 12.12.2009 Где: на Марсе Репутация: нет Всего: 1 |
LSD, ты зачем такой жестокий?
![]() ![]() -------------------- Advocatus Dei ![]() ![]() |
|||
|
||||
![]() ![]() ![]() |
Правила ведения Религиозных войн | |
|
1. Уважайте собеседника 2. Собеседник != враг 3. Старайтесь воздерживаться от тем вида "Windows Rulez" или "Linux Rulez" С уважением, Smartov. |
1 Пользователей читают эту тему (1 Гостей и 0 Скрытых Пользователей) | |
0 Пользователей: | |
« Предыдущая тема | Религиозные войны | Следующая тема » |
|
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ности Powered by Invision Power Board(R) 1.3 © 2003 IPS, Inc. |